Wanted: Linux user to compile pre-alpha

I've had a report that the Angband variant I'm working on won't run under Linux. I don't have Linux (and I didn't think I'd changed anything that would have broken it ...). So basically I'd be grateful if somebody could download the SVN and check whether it runs or not.

If you could fix it as well I'd be REALLY grateful.

See
http://sourceforge.jp/projects/angband65/

It's code altered from the latest Vanilla Angband SVN so it should be quite familiar to Angband developers.
